I just browsed into the topic, but K8WE is fully based on NVIDIA
kludge chipsets, the chipsets company is not open source friendly, I
don't think you will get good support from open source world, based
on the point, Intel is still the best X86 Server platform except its
CPU problem.

UPDATE on the AMD K8 chipsets:
Serverworks introduced 2 K8 chipsets with MP capability, so there are 2 good choices for AMD machines right now.


AMD and ServerWorks (which also made some good P-x Chipsets)

So we have: VIA, AMD, ULI, SIS, NVIDIA, ATI and ServerWorks chipsets for the K8 platform.

In my opinion the chipset isnt a reason for or against intel or amd.
